TapTap

Games worth discovering

iconicon
EA SPORTS™ WRC
icon
Porque me ...-SillyDragon's Posts - TapTap

2025-09-02
Porque me gusta mucho los juegos de rally
Mentioned games
iconView desktop site

TapTap looks better

on the app love-tato

Open with TapTap